Black November

ATÉ 50% OFF

TÁ ACABANDO!

0 dias

0 horas

0 min

0 seg

1
resposta

[Projeto] Comando Break Lista de Livros

import random

livros = ["1984", "Dom Casmurro", "O Pequeno Príncipe", "O Hobbit", "Orgulho e Preconceito"]
random.shuffle(livros)

for i in livros:
    if i == "O Hobbit":
        break
    else:
        print("O Livro: ",i)

Matricule-se agora e aproveite até 50% OFF

O maior desconto do ano para você evoluir com a maior escola de tecnologia

QUERO APROVEITAR
1 resposta

Oi, Bruno! Como vai?

Agradeço por compartilhar.

Ficou claro que você organizou bem a lógica do break e usou a função shuffle para variar a lista, o que deixa o exercício mais interessante. Sua estrutura está funcionando conforme a proposta da atividade.

Uma dica interessante para o futuro é usar o método enumerate quando quiser acessar o índice junto ao valor.


livros = ["A", "B", "C"]
for indice, nome in enumerate(livros):
    print(indice, nome)

Esse codigo mostra o indice e o nome de cada item na lista.

Alura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!